Output ee24e2112978264382de3dff8e14b2a298209a183171b6d5a102ef2f39aed94a:1

value
3998965
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b17506b3243b9755106f4d3cd3b28bda3bc19e0b OP_EQUALVERIFY OP_CHECKSIG
address
1HBJo5LwPKHXHZbjBqGgtruSuZ8GT3zYb9
transaction
ee24e2112978264382de3dff8e14b2a298209a183171b6d5a102ef2f39aed94a
confirmations
440998
spent
true